Happiness

Hannah Jones

I wear a yellow sweater With yellow earrings On this rainy November day, And I vow to myself to take happiness with me Wherever I go, Like chocolate-chip banana bread Still warm, a live coal, Like a Mozart opera stuck in my head, Displacing dour and useless thoughts, Always nearing the chorus, Like love, Intangible, but so real Because I believe in it, Myfinenewclothes That only the heart can see. And so I take my yellow Out into the rain, And I am a passing sun With matching earrings.
